7 meaningful Indian names for baby boys starting with letter "P"

Choosing the perfect name for a baby boy is a delightful yet significant task for parents. Names not only reflect identity but also carry cultural, spiritual, and personal meanings. Here are seven meaningful Indian names starting with the letter “P,” along with their descriptions and meanings. Selecting a name is a meaningful journey, and these seven names beginning with “P” beautifully combine tradition, spiritual significance, and modern charm.

2/8

Pratyush

Derived from Sanskrit, Pratyush means “the first ray of the sun” or “dawn.” It symbolizes hope, new beginnings, and positivity, representing a bright future for the child. The name inspires energy, optimism, and a fresh perspective on life.

3/8

Pranav

Derived from Sanskrit, Pranav symbolizes the sacred syllable “Om,” representing the universe and ultimate reality. This name is often associated with spirituality, purity, and the essence of life, making it an ideal choice for parents seeking a name with deep philosophical roots.

4/8

Parth

One of the many names of the legendary warrior Arjuna from the Mahabharata, Parth represents courage, righteousness, and determination. It is a strong, meaningful name often chosen to inspire valor and moral integrity.

5/8

Prajwal

Meaning “bright” or “blazing,” Prajwal signifies brilliance, energy, and enlightenment. It reflects positivity and a radiant personality, inspiring a child to shine in all aspects of life. This name is often chosen for its modern yet meaningful appeal.

6/8

Prithul

A unique and elegant name, Prithul means “expansive” or “generous.” It symbolizes a person with a broad heart, wisdom, and a magnanimous nature, making it perfect for parents who wish to instill noble values from an early age.

7/8

Pulkit

Pulkit translates to “happy,” “thrilled,” or “excited.” This lively name conveys joy, enthusiasm, and positivity, suggesting a spirited child who brings happiness and energy to those around him.

8/8

Pranay

Meaning “love” or “affection,” Pranay reflects warmth, compassion, and a loving personality. This beautiful name conveys a sense of harmony and emotional depth, making it perfect for parents wishing to embrace kindness and care.
